[0028] Embodiment. The specific embodiment of the present invention is described with this example and the present invention is described further. This example is an experimental prototype, its composition is as follows Figure 1-Figure 5 shown.

[0029] In this example, the production and domestic water supply of a certain station is supplied by a deep well 5 kilometers away from the station. There are two deep wells. The model of the deep well pump is 200QJ20-108, and the power of the motor is 13.5KW. The water consumption of the deep well varies from time to time, which cannot be adapted to the set start time of the deep well pump. Under the premise of ensuring normal water consumption, a large amount of water will flow from the overflow port on the upper side of the reservoir to the sewer. The waste is serious, so that the deep well pump and the sewage pump run uninterruptedly for a long time, consume electricity, and have a large amount of maintenance.

Abstract

The invention provides a deep-well pump remote control device, and relates to the technical field of pumps and control. The device comprises a water-level remote control system and a station control circuit and water-level control and on-site control circuit. The station control circuit and water-level control and on-site control circuit serving as a data transmission channel is connected with the water-level remote control system through a GSM mobile communication network by means of a mobile phone card. The remote control system comprises a water-level sampling circuit, a system micro controller, a GSM module and a mobile phone. The first electricity principle of station control circuit and water-level control comprises a plurality of switches, and the second electricity principle of the station control circuit and water-level control comprises a module composed of a mobile phone module SIM 3000 and an AT89S52 single chip microcomputer, a plurality of relays and a plurality of switches; the on-site control principle comprises two portions, the first portion of the on-site control principle comprises a plurality of relays and switches, and the other portion of the on-site control secondary circuit principle comprises an AT89S52, relays and switches. According to the deep-well pump remote control device, the control distance is far, control is reliable and maintenance is easy.

Description

technical field [0001] The invention is a remote control device for a deep well pump. Involved in the field of pump and control technology. Background technique [0002] At present, the remote control devices of deep well pumps are mostly connected to the two ends with control cables through overhead lines, so as to control the start and stop of deep well pumps 5 kilometers away with the liquid level of the water storage tank. The distance is long, the voltage drop is large, the maintenance is difficult, and the control is unreliable. [0003] CN201689297U discloses a water supply remote control device, which includes a power supply circuit, a watchdog circuit, a memory circuit, a communication module circuit, a processor circuit, a clock circuit, a digital input circuit, an amplifier circuit, and a relay output circuit, but does not disclose specific circuit.
